MFT Gateway is a managed file transfer service that allows secure transfer of files between organizations. It enables automation and provides visibility into file transfers.
FileXpress is a file transfer and workflow automation software solution. It allows users to easily transfer files of any size securely and reliably using standard network protocols. Key features include workflow design, process automation, thorough reporting, and integrations with other systems.
